Roald Dahl Day, celebrated on 13 September, is a perfect opportunity to introduce your class to books that have inspired children for generations. He is renowned for creating memorable characters: from the eccentric Mr Fox and the Grand High Witch to the extraordinary, yet easily relatable, Matilda, James, and Charlie.
